Frequently asked questions

How often do Hungary and Samoa vote together at the UN?

Hungary and Samoa voted the same way in 70.8% of 3,825 shared UN General Assembly votes since 1946.

Do Hungary and Samoa agree on human rights votes?

On human rights resolutions, Hungary and Samoa largely agree: they voted the same way in 72.2% of 727 shared human-rights votes at the UN General Assembly.

When did Hungary and Samoa last disagree at the UN?

Among their biggest recent splits, on 2017-12-04 Hungary voted "no" and Samoa voted "yes" on A/RES/72/31 (Taking forward multilateral nuclear disarmament negotiations : resolution / adopted by the General Assembly).
